The M-346 is designed for the main role of a lead-in fighter trainer, in which aircraft's performance and capabilities are used to deliver pilot training for the latest generation of combat fighter aircraft. Powered by a pair of Honeywell/ITEC F124-GA-200 turbofan engines of 28 kN (6,300 lbf) thrust each, and designed to reduce acquisition and operating costs, the M-246 is capable of transonic flight without using an afterburner.

 

As good and comprehensive the initial release was, there was always going to be a developer follow up to do adjustments and address the few bugs outstanding. And here it is with the update version of v1.0.0_1r1.

 

Like the aircraft the update is very comprehensive. It has three sections; Fixes, Additions and Improvements. In "Additions" there is now a more realistic canopy open/close switch and Pressure lever. and a better Realistic Nose Wheel Steering system....  (I found the nosewheel didn't turn very wide), so it is related to this. There were added in more "Format" pages into the three MFDs (Multi-Function Display), covering the CNI, COMM1 SET & LIST, VOR/ILS SET & LIST, TACAN SET & LIST and Implementation of the IFF SET MFD format page.

 

There are also Flight Model and Autopilot Improvements. Thrust and Drag, Airfoils Behaviour and Roll & Pitch rate improvements. Particle and Sound Adjustments...   and a Plus+ is the new extra livery "BLUE".
 
Fixes:
 ⁃ Fixed LEF working according to AOA when TEF or Gear is down.
 ⁃ Fixed Speed Brake limiter when full flaps to be 40 Degrees instead of 50.
 ⁃ Fixed GHD display not using the standby barometric setting.
 ⁃ Fixed LEF and TEF Markings on the fuselage to show the correct positions.
 ⁃ Fixed COMM1, COMM2, TACAN, VOR/ILS & IFF format pages on both UFCP and MFDs to not show if the corresponding system is not operating.
 ⁃ Fixed Elec System not powering down the displays some times.
 ⁃ Fixed AoA HUD symbol during Landing to much 8 minimum, 10 optimal and 12 maximum AoA.
 ⁃ Fixed FPM, CDM, FRL HUD indication.
 ⁃ Fixed Roll Axis being on the bottom of the plane.
 ⁃ Fixed Ailerons and Elevators providing braking during landing.
 ⁃ Fixed black clouds coming out of the engine.
 ⁃ Fixed Blank spaces in all displays.
 ⁃ Fixed mach indication on CADI.
 ⁃ Fixed turbine rotation animation.
 ⁃ Fixed internal and external fuel to match the real jet.
Additions:
 ⁃ Implementation of a realistic canopy open/close switch and Pressure lever.
 ⁃ Implementation of a realistic Nose Wheel Steering system.
 ⁃ Implementation of the CNI MFD format page.
 ⁃ Implementation of the COMM1 SET & LIST MFD format page.
 ⁃ Implementation of the VOR/ILS SET & LIST MFD format page.
 ⁃ Implementation of the TACAN SET & LIST MFD format page.
 ⁃ Implementation of the IFF SET MFD format page.
 ⁃ Implementation of a realistic Anti-Ice system.
 ⁃ Implementation of 53 authentic sound warnings.
Improvements:
 ⁃ Flight Model Improvements.
 ⁃ Autopilot Improvements.
 ⁃ CTR adjustment on all displays.
 ⁃ Thrust and Drag Improvements.
 ⁃ Airfoils Behaviour Improvements.
 ⁃ Roll & Pitch rate improvements.
 ⁃ MFDs System Overhaul.
 ⁃ COMM1 & 2 format pages on UFCP more accurate representation.
 ⁃ Refuel probe state is now being saved after changing it.
 ⁃ Extra Free livery.
 ⁃ Textures adjustments.
 ⁃ 3D adjustments.
 ⁃ Particles adjustments.
 ⁃ Sound adjustments.
